Transaction 2955bd72f4dee3cecffb55a88b4dc8df9e5fec88f59826fa34c10de304e69af4
1 Input
1 Output
-
2955bd72f4dee3cecffb55a88b4dc8df9e5fec88f59826fa34c10de304e69af4:0
- value
- 3498642
- script pubkey
- OP_0 OP_PUSHBYTES_20 5867380e438e45084f777fb29c1682980fd675ba
- address
- bc1qtpnnsrjr3ezssnmh07efc95znq8avad6kknhc6